The frescoes on the ceiling, collectively known as the sistine ceiling, were commissioned by pope julius ii in 1508 and were painted by michelangelo in the years from 1508 to 1512. One of the most famous churches in rome is the sistine chapel. A fresco painting is a work of wall or ceiling art created by applying pigment onto intonaco, or a thin layer of plaster.
